Many properties across Nassau and Suffolk County have natural slopes that make landscaping difficult. Without proper retention, soil erodes during heavy rains, mulch washes away, and planting beds lose their shape season after season. A garden wall holds soil firmly in place, creates level planting surfaces at different elevations, and channels water where it needs to go. The result is a landscape that stays intact through every Long Island storm and freeze-thaw cycle.
We offer Cambridge and Nicolock interlocking wall systems in a variety of textures, colors, and profiles, as well as natural fieldstone and bluestone for homeowners who prefer an organic look. Every garden wall starts with a compacted aggregate base, with the first course set partially below grade for stability. Behind the wall, we place drainage aggregate and perforated pipe to prevent hydrostatic pressure buildup. For taller walls, geogrid reinforcement layers tie the wall into the retained soil mass. Cap options include natural bluestone, limestone, and matching wall system caps that protect the top course and provide a polished finishing touch.

Islip Terrace's compact residential lots on flat South Shore terrain require space-efficient hardscape designs where every inch of grading matters for proper drainage on limited property. The community's postwar housing stock features uniform paving challenges: aging concrete stoops, cracked asphalt driveways, and deteriorated walkways that benefit from wholesale replacement rather than ongoing patch repairs. Sandy soils provide easy excavation conditions but require a well-constructed aggregate base to prevent the gradual settlement that has already affected most original installations.
